Thanks, On Fri, May 31, 2013 at 4:04 PM, Alex Wang <al...@nicira.com> wrote: > This patch changes the variable type of "ofport" in "struct if_cfg" and > "struct iface" from int64_t to uint16_t. This is more consistent with > the OpenFlow-1.0 port definition. > > Also, before this patch, -1 is used to indicate an unknown port.
